Regardless of how it comes about, the dialogue will contain a preponderance of vocabulary we’re all intimately familiar with in our own relationships, from probing questions like どうしたの (what happened), 何ですか (what is it) and 何で (なんで — why), to evasive replies such as 何でもない (なんでもない — nothing), 大丈夫 (だいじょうぶ — it’s fine) and 別に (べつに — not particularly), to aggressive retorts including ばか (jerk), 嘘つき (うそつき — liar) and 面倒くさい (めんどうくさい — what a pain), to protests and declarations of remorse along the lines of ごめん (sorry), 待って (まって — wait) and 違う (ちがう — it’s not like that). Anime (Japanese: アニメ, IPA: ()) is hand-drawn and computer animation originating from Japan.In Japan and in Japanese, anime (a term derived from the English word animation), describes all animated works, regardless of style or origin.Outside of Japan and in English, anime is colloquial for Japanese animation and refers specifically to animation produced in Japan. Many of these stories will deal with confessions of 好き (すき — liking) or 愛してる (あいしてる — loving) someone, not uncommonly based on 約束 (やくそく — promises) from childhood or answering a cry for 助けて (たすけて — help).
